Dehaloperoxidase
Dehaloperoxidase (DHP) is a heme-containing globin possessing peroxidase enzymatic activity. DHP catalyzes the peroxide-dependent dehalogenation of halophenol. DHP A and DHP B are isoenzymes of DHP.[1] Structural highlights. [2] 3D structures of dehaloperoxidaseDehaloperoxidase 3D structures
